• ベストアンサー

Delphi

Delphiでファイルの移動をしたいのですが どのようなコーディングになるのでしょうか。 お知りの方、おいでになりましたら ご教授お願い致します。

質問者が選んだベストアンサー

  • ベストアンサー
  • bouyapin
  • ベストアンサー率60% (6/10)
回答No.3

CopyFileというAPIを使って、処理が成功したらコピーもとのファイルを削除すればよろしいのでは? var Ret:Boolean; MotoName,SakiName:PChar; begin if CopyFile(MotoName, SakiName, False) then begin DeleteFile(MotoName); end else begin // 失敗処理 end; end; と私はしてますが。

その他の回答 (2)

回答No.2

通常のwindowsアプリでの操作ならCopyFileAPI,SHFileOperationAPI 視覚的に操作するならDragModeプロパティーで普通は作ると思います。

  • Hardking
  • ベストアンサー率45% (73/160)
回答No.1

RenameまたはRenameFile関数で行います。 但し、移動制限があり同一ドライブ内のみです。

shin-cyan
質問者

お礼

早速のご回答ありがとうございます。 フォルダー間の移動はできないでしょうか?

関連するQ&A

専門家に質問してみよう